Quest头显开机自动串流配置
1. 背景
解决Quest新近升级系统(2025年以后),账号频繁掉线及官方串流慢且不稳定的问题。
2. 需求
- 头显开机自动串流
- 最好可无视系统账号登录需求
3. 配置方式
3.1 QuestOS系统准备
- 下载QuestOS系统镜像,最好是该系列中风评较好的稳定版本,下载可参考历史镜像列表
- 用sideload模式安装新系统(只能比出厂版本高,无法降级)
- 头显关机
- 按住音量-键和电源键保持几秒,等头显屏幕出现控制台界面松开
- 用音量+/-键选择
sideload模式,按电源键确认 - 用数据线连接头显和电脑,打开adb命令,输入
adb devices,查看头显是否连接成功(此时应显示设备名+sideload) - 输入
adb sideload <镜像文件路径>,回车,等待头显自动重启,开机后即可完成系统安装
- 初始化系统,激活登录账号,打开开发者模式(重要)
注:也可先激活账号,打开开发者模式后再用sideload升级至统一系统,此种情况新升级系统默认开启adb权限
3.2 串流软件准备
- 下载ALVR软件包
- 下载VB-Cable驱动包
- 运行VB-Cable x64驱动,选择
Install Driver,安装虚拟驱动,并重启电脑 - 运行
ALVR Dashboard, 根据提示安装ALVR环境(VB驱动前序已安装跳过) - USB连接Quest头显和电脑,运行
adb devices,在头显中点击始终允许这台电脑连接 - ALVR设置
- Devices面板:
Wired Connection: 选中
- Settings面板:
Connection标签页:Auto trust clients:选中(若同时开通WIFI与有线,则不选中,否则有可能干扰)Wired client autolauhch: 选中
Extra标签页:Driver launch action: 选择No action
- Installation面板:
- 确认
Registered drivers是否有值,若无,点击Register ALVR driver按钮注册
- 确认
- Devices面板:
3.3 离线版SteamVR配置
- 下载离线版SteamVR资源包(推荐1.27.5版本)
- 解压资源包,运行其中的bin/win64/vrstartup.exe,激活SteamVR配置
- 打开
%localappdata%/openvr/openvrpaths.vrpath,修改runtime为SteamVR配置路径 - 将
config和log字段值设为%localappdata%/openvr下面的config和logs文件夹。 - 确认
external_drivers字段值为alvr配置目录 - 示例配置
{
"config" :
[
"C:\\Users\\XXX\\AppData\\Local\\openvr\\config"
],
"external_drivers" :
[
"D:\\GreenTools\\alvr_streamer_windows"
],
"jsonid" : "vrpathreg",
"log" :
[
"C:\\Users\\XXX\\AppData\\Local\\openvr\\logs"
],
"runtime" :
[
"D:\\GreenTools\\SteamVR_1.27.5\\SteamVR"
],
"version" : 1
}
- 关联steam://协议,正常从ALVR启动SteamVR
# 注册steam://协议 [HKEY_CLASSES_ROOT\steam] @="URL:Steam Protocol" "URL Protocol"="" [HKEY_CLASSES_ROOT\steam\shell\open\command] @="\"PathToSteamVR\\vrmonitor.exe\""
3.4 全系统初始化
- 安装ALVR头显客户端
adb install alvr_client_stable.apk
adb shell am start -n alvr.client.stable/android.app.NativeActivity
注: 如头显还能正常进系统,也可以在安装alvr_client_stable后,在未知来源中打开应用
- 运行ALVR的
Launch StreamVR - 正常状况应该显示状态如下:
- 菜单栏
SteamVR: Connected - Devices面板:
Wired Connection: Streaming
- 菜单栏
- 确保SteamVR菜单栏中设置面板,OpenXR选项中,
OpenXR Runtime选择SteamVR
4. 其它
- 初始化运行成功后,可将
%localappdata%/openvr/openvrpaths.vrpath文件设为只读,防止配置被修改 - 将
vrmonitor.exe设置快捷方式,方便快速启动 - 头显端无需做其它操作,默认开机自动进入串流环境
- 默认初始化后的头显,不做任何操作,开机会自动打开串流功能
- 若头显打开过其它软件,则有可能启动顺序被替换,需要手动打开一下alvr客户端,可用adb和第三方加载程序两种方式打开(未激活系统的情况下)
- adb方式:
adb shell am start -n alvr.client.stable/android.app.NativeActivity - 加载程序方式:
- adb安装QuestAppLauncher.apk
- 在头显中打开QuestAppLauncher,在
All标签页中找到ALVR,点击启动
- adb方式:
- 有问题需调试时,可运行
ALVR Dashbord进行细节分析

8042

被折叠的 条评论
为什么被折叠?



